Said to be amongst the top 50 schools in India, Delhi Public School Jalandhar is a CBSE affiliated school located in Jalandhar Cantonment, Punjab. In 2018, Pricewaterhouse Coopers India in partnership with Fortune Magazine had featured its name in the Fortune 50 Schools of India. It has also been the best school in the state in at least two categories -‘Academic Results' and ‘Co-curricular Activities' as per the National Education Conference and Awards - 2018.
Established in 2002, DPS Jalandhar is the first choice for most parents in the region. It has one of the best infrastructure and facilities for its students. It has classes running from pre-nursery to higher secondary. The campus is spread over 10 acres of lush green land. With 2,00,000 sq. ft. of open space, it provides a green and serene surrounding, very much conducive for effective learning. Located away from the main city, the school gets a pollution-free atmosphere. However, its location on the GT Road ensures that students have easy access to the school from all parts of the city.
Infrastructure facilities Like every DPS school, DPS Jalandhar has the best of facilities. Right from an early age itself, the students get exposure to the latest in technologies. There are a number of labs in this respect, such as computer labs, a robotics lab and activity & science labs. Starting from simple to complex, from Grade 4 onwards, students get to participate in various projects involving robotics, automation, programming and the like.
It is not all work but no play in DPS Jalandhar. Like all best schools, sports and cultural activities also play an important part in the all-around development of the students at this school. Be it swimming, taekwondo, golf, basketball, lawn tennis, table tennis, cricket or any other sport, the school has all the facilities the students need. It even has a splash pool for the pre-primary section. Many amongst the students have represented the school at the district, state and in some cases at the national level in a variety of sports and have thus made the school proud. There are also activities like fancy dress competitions, slogan writing contests, poster making and pool parties that help students showcase their creative skills.
The school has an NCC wing of its own, through which the students get to participate in a number of adventure activities and training camps. The Student Council provides students with the opportunity to hone and showcase their leadership skills. Students are encouraged to show their mettle and the ablest amongst them are selected as Head Boy, Head Girl, Sports Captains, Literary Captains and Cultural Captains in an Investiture Ceremony that is a big day for the school and its students. The Scholar Badge Ceremony is also a special day for the school when highly meritorious students are awarded scholar badges, blazers and scholarships depending upon their academic achievements.
Admissions For admission to the school, parents will have to first register their wards name by filling out a registration form. The application form can be obtained from the school administrative office as and when the school releases them. Parents may also register online by visiting the admission page of the school's website. Online registration can be done any time during the year. Application forms once released by the school are to be filled and submitted within a week's time from its release.
For pre-nursery, nursery and prep, admissions will be on the basis of interaction and observation by the teachers. Both parents need to be present during the interaction.
For classes 1 and above, if there are vacancies, there will be a written test. Only those clearing the test will be called for the interactive session. Again, both parents need to be present during the session.
The age limit for the pre-nursery students is 2 ½ to 3 ½, 3 ½ to 4 ½ for nursery, 4 ½ to 5 ½ for prep and 5 ½ to 6 ½ for class 1.
The important documents that need to be submitted during the registration are as follows. - Filled-in registration form
- Marks memo of previous class
- Proof of date of birth
- Aadhaar copy
- Passport size colour photographs - two in numbers
